  • Hi, this is Karen. I am a huge fan of crystal and healing stones and I make handmade jewelry. In this video, I showed you a simple way of making elastic cords bracelets with two cords, three cords, and four cords, and how to tie the knots correctly and tug the strings into the bead hole.

    Hey! I just want to warn all of you guys who love natural stones (like myself) to be careful with a certain type that is often called "zebra jasper". It's actually pure chrysotile asbestos and is not a hard stone that can be easily damaged and therefore can release asbestos particles into the air that you or your kids may then inhale. The problem is that many sellers have no idea what they are selling as most opaque stones are simply labelled jasper so the best thing you can do is Google what it looks like and avoid stones that resemble it in the future.
